What is Hash Rate?
Hash rate is a measure of how quickly a computer can perform cryptographic hashes. In the context of Ethereum mining, it refers to how many hashes a GPU can compute per second. The higher the hash rate, the more likely you are to solve a block and earn rewards.
3060 Ti FE ETH Hashrate: The Numbers
The N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 Ti FE has a base clock of 1665 MHz and a boost clock of 1785 MHz. According to various sources, its Ethereum hash rate ranges from 42 MH/s to 48 MH/s. This makes it a solid choice for Ethereum mining, especially considering its relatively affordable price.
